STXG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review
15 of the 6,302 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Strive 1000 Growth ETF (STXG)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$6.74M — up 4.2% from $6.47M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 5 funds opened new STXG posit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 6 added to existing stakes and 3 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Whitener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$246K. The largest seller was Cambridge Investment Research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$244K sold.
